Why Oatmeal is the Ultimate Healthy Breakfast
Before we dive into the deliciousness, let’s break down why oatmeal should be a breakfast staple:
-
Heart-Healthy: Rich in beta-glucan, oats help reduce bad cholesterol.
-
Fiber-Packed: Keeps you full longer, preventing mid-morning cravings.
-
Low-Glycemic: Helps stabilize blood sugar levels.
-
Budget-Friendly: One of the most affordable whole grains around.
-
Versatile: Can be sweet or savory, hot or cold.
And with the right ingredients, oatmeal transforms into a nutrient-dense powerhouse that tastes as good as it feels.
The Base Recipe: How to Cook Oatmeal Perfectly Every Time
No matter the toppings or mix-ins, it all starts with a solid base.
Ingredients:
-
½ cup rolled oats
-
1 cup water or milk (or a mix)
-
Pinch of salt
Instructions:
-
Combine oats, liquid, and salt in a saucepan.
-
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er.
-
Cook for 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ally until creamy.
-
Serve hot and dress it up with your favorite toppings.

Healthy Oatmeal Recipes for Summer Mornings

1. Berry Coconut Oatmeal Bowl
This one’s for those balmy mornings when all you want is something light and refreshing.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al
-
½ cup fresh mixed berries (blueberries, strawberries, raspberries)
-
1 tbsp shredded unsweetened coconut
-
1 tsp chia seeds
-
Drizzle of honey or maple syrup
-
Splash of almond milk
Nutrition Tip: Berries are loaded with antioxidants that fight inflammation and support skin health.
2. Peach & Almond Butter Overnight Oats
No stove required! Prep the night before and wake up to a chilled breakfast.
Ingredients:
-
½ cup rolled oats
-
½ cup almond milk
-
½ fresh peach, sliced
-
1 tbsp almond butter
-
1 tsp flaxseeds
-
Pinch of cinnamon
Method: Mix all ingredients in a mason jar, refrigerate overnight, and enjoy cold.
3. Tropical Green Smoothie Oats
This unique combo blends your morning smoothie with hearty oats.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al
-
½ banana
-
¼ cup pineapple
-
Handful spinach
-
½ cup coconut water
-
1 tbsp hemp seeds
Blend the fruits and greens, pour over oatmeal, and top with coconut flakes.
Why it’s great: It hydrates and energizes without the sugar crash.
Healthy Oatmeal Recipes for Cozy Winter Mornings
4. Apple Pie Oatmeal
All the flavors of a classic dessert in a healthy bowl.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al
-
½ apple, diced and sautéed in coconut oil
-
¼ tsp cinnamon
-
⅛ tsp nutmeg
-
Walnuts or pecans for crunch
-
A dash of maple syrup
Comfort in a bowl that’s perfect for cold mornings.
5. Pumpkin Spice Oats
A fall and winter favorite packed with fiber and warming spices.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al
-
¼ cup pumpkin puree
-
¼ tsp pumpkin pie spice
-
1 tbsp Greek yogurt (for creaminess)
-
Pumpkin seeds and a sprinkle of cinnamon on top
Perfect for those who can’t wait for pumpkin season.
6. Cranberry Orange Winter Glow Oats
Bright citrus meets tart berries—just what your immune system ordered.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al
-
Zest of ½ orange + juice
-
¼ cup dried cranberries (unsweetened, if possible)
-
1 tbsp almond slivers
-
Honey to taste
Pro tip: Add a splash of vanilla extract to tie it all together.
Bonus: Savory Healthy Oatmeal Ideas
Yes, oatmeal can go savory too! These are great for protein-rich breakfasts.
7. Savory Spinach & Egg Oats

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al (use water or vegetable broth)
-
1 soft-boiled egg
-
Handful of spinach (sautéed)
-
Sprinkle of feta or parmesan
-
Black pepper and chili flakes
Great alternative to your usual toast-and-egg routine.
8. Miso Mushroom Oats
Earthy, umami-rich, and deeply satisfying.
Ingredients:
-
Base oatmeal (use water or broth)
-
1 tsp miso paste
-
Sautéed mushrooms
-
Green onions
-
Toasted sesame seeds
Packed with flavor and probiotics.
Oatmeal Meal Prep: Save Time & Eat Well
Want to save time during the week? Try making a big batch of oatmeal and storing it in the fridge.
-
Make-ahead tips: Cook 3–4 servings, portion into jars, and customize each with different toppings.
-
Reheat & serve: Add a splash of milk, microwave, stir, and you’re ready to go!
Expert Tips for Perfect Healthy Oatmeal
-
Use steel-cut oats for a chewier texture and longer digestion time.
-
Soak oats overnight to reduce phytic acid and improve nutrient absorption.
-
Add protein with Greek yogurt, protein powder, eggs, or nut butters.
-
Sneak in veggies like zucchini (zucchini bread oats!) or spinach for extra fiber.
-
Spice it up with cinnamon, cardamom, or turmeric for anti-inflammatory benefits.
